Preparing Your Mouse for Cleaning

Proper preparation reduces the risk of damage and ensures a thorough clean. Before any mouse taking a shower scenario, power down and disconnect the device.

Remove batteries or unplug the USB receiver. Use a soft brush to clear debris from buttons and crevices. Place the mouse on a clean towel to prevent slipping during the process.

Power Safety

Always turn off the mouse and unplug any wired connections to protect internal circuits. This step is critical before exposing the device to moisture.

External Rinse Planning

Focus on the outer shell and buttons where oils and dust accumulate. Avoid spraying water directly into openings; instead, dampen a cloth and wipe carefully.

Deep Cleaning Techniques

Deep cleaning targets hidden grime while preserving sensor performance. A mouse taking a shower in controlled conditions can look like a careful surface bath rather than a full immersion.

Use a microfiber cloth lightly dampened with isopropyl alcohol for stubborn marks. Cotton swabs help clean tight spaces around scroll wheels and side buttons.

Sensor and Lens Area

The optical sensor window needs gentle treatment. Wipe it with a dry microfiber cloth to avoid scratches that could affect tracking precision.

Button and Grip Care

Pay attention to textured grips where sweat and skin cells build up. Mild soap can be used sparingly, followed by thorough rinsing and drying.

Drying and Reassembly

Moisture removal is as important as the cleaning itself. Let the mouse air dry in an upright position to prevent water pooling inside the shell.

Ensure all parts are completely dry before reconnecting or inserting batteries. Reattach covers and test all buttons and scroll functions for smooth operation.

Preventive Maintenance Habits

Regular care minimizes the need for intensive cleaning sessions. Simple habits protect both hygiene and hardware longevity.

  • Wipe the mouse weekly with a dry microfiber cloth
  • Avoid eating over the device to reduce crumb contamination
  • Use a mouse pad to limit abrasive wear on feet and shell
  • Store in a dust-free environment when not in use

FAQ

Reader questions

Can I put my wireless mouse in the sink for a full shower?

No, submerging a wireless mouse can ruin the battery contacts and internal circuitry; stick to external wiping and minimal moisture.

Is it safe to use cleaning wipes on the mouse shell?

Yes, use lightly dampened electronics-safe wipes, avoiding excess liquid near buttons and openings to protect sensitive parts.

How do I dry a mouse after accidental water exposure?

Gently pat it dry with a towel, then leave it in a well-ventilated area for several hours before testing or reconnecting.

Will cleaning the mouse void its warranty?

Gentle cleaning with manufacturer-approved methods typically does not void the warranty; avoid harsh chemicals or disassembly beyond guidelines.
